A Legacy of Greatness
When you hear the words "Brazilian football," what comes to mind? For most, it's probably images of dazzling skills, impossible goals, and a team that embodies the beautiful game. The Brazilian national team has consistently delivered on this promise, etching their name into the history books time and again. Their journey is paved with triumphs, unforgettable moments, and a roster of iconic players who've captivated fans across the globe. Winning the FIFA World Cup a record five times (1958, 1962, 1970, 1994, and 2002) is a testament to their enduring quality and dominance. Each of these victories represents more than just a trophy; they symbolize Brazil's unique footballing culture and philosophy. They have also won nine Copa América titles and four FIFA Confederations Cups, and have a history of success in other international competitions. The Seleção’s style of play, often referred to as "Joga Bonito" (the beautiful game), emphasizes flair, creativity, and attacking prowess. This approach has not only brought them success but has also influenced footballing styles worldwide. From Pelé to Zico, Romário to Ronaldo, and more recently, Neymar, the team has consistently produced players who redefine what's possible on the pitch. Each generation has built upon the legacy of the previous one, contributing to the rich tapestry of Brazilian football history. Tactics and Formations
The tactics and formations employed by the Seleção are constantly evolving, reflecting the changing landscape of modern football. The Brazilian national team is known for its attacking flair, but tactical discipline and defensive solidity are also crucial components of their game. Throughout history, the team has experimented with various formations,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. The classic 4-2-2-2 formation, with its emphasis on attacking midfielders and overlapping full-backs, has been a popular choice. This formation allows the team to control possession, create scoring opportunities, and exploit spaces in the opponent's defense. However, it can also leave the team vulnerable to counter-attacks if the midfielders are not disciplined in their defensive duties. Another common formation is the 4-3-3, which provides a more balanced approach. This formation features three central midfielders, one of whom typically plays as a defensive midfielder, providing cover for the back four. The three forwards are responsible for creating scoring opportunities and pressing the opponent's defense.
